摘要: WebDriver高阶API(4) 8、右键另存为下载文件AutoIt脚本:;ControlFocus("title","text",controlID);表示将焦点切换到标题为title窗体中的controlID上;Edit1表示第一个可以编辑的实例;title表示弹出的Window窗口标题,不同 阅读全文
posted @ 2019-03-27 18:40 测试小子 阅读(149) 评论(0) 推荐(0) 编辑
摘要: WebDriver高阶API(3) 2)模拟键盘操作,实现上传文件 3)使用第三方工具AutoIt上传文件需要安装AutoIt工具 autoit-v3-setup.exe和 SciTE4AutoIt3.exe在编辑器中输入文件上传的脚本,如下:#include<Constants.au3> Send 阅读全文
posted @ 2019-03-26 18:26 测试小子 阅读(189) 评论(0) 推荐(0) 编辑
摘要: WebDriver高阶API(2) 5、更改页面对象属性值 (使用JS修改) 6、自动下载文件 电脑上没有Firefox浏览器,本段代码未执行 7、上传文件1)、使用send_keys 阅读全文
posted @ 2019-03-25 17:46 测试小子 阅读(239) 评论(0) 推荐(0) 编辑
摘要: WebDriver高阶API(1) 1、使用JavaScript操作页面元素 2、操作滚动条 JS 3、操作Ajax产生的浮动框 方法一:通过模拟键盘下箭头进行选择悬浮框选项 方法二:通过匹配模糊内容选择悬浮框中选项 方法三:固定选择某一项,使用索引 4、结束Windows中浏览器进程 阅读全文
posted @ 2019-03-20 18:31 测试小子 阅读(218) 评论(0) 推荐(0) 编辑
摘要: Selenium Webdriver API(9) 44、操作JavaScript的comfirm弹窗 45、操作JavaScript的prompt弹窗 46、操作浏览器Cookie 练习:登录163邮箱 阅读全文
posted @ 2019-03-18 14:28 测试小子 阅读(187) 评论(0) 推荐(0) 编辑
摘要: Selenium Webdriver API(8) 40、操作frame中的元素 switch_to.frame 41、使用frame源码定位frame 42、操作iframe 43、操作JavaScript的Alert弹窗 阅读全文
posted @ 2019-03-15 17:48 测试小子 阅读(186) 评论(0) 推荐(0) 编辑
摘要: Selenium Webdriver API(7) 37、隐式等待 implicitly_wait#encoding=utf-8import unittestimport timefrom selenium import webdriverfrom selenium.webdriver import 阅读全文
posted @ 2019-03-15 10:08 测试小子 阅读(194) 评论(0) 推荐(0) 编辑
摘要: Selenium Webdriver API(5)31、键盘操作-F12#encoding=utf-8import timeimport unittestfrom selenium import webdriver class VisitSogouByIE(unittest.TestCase): d 阅读全文
posted @ 2019-03-13 18:00 测试小子 阅读(227) 评论(0) 推荐(0) 编辑
摘要: Selenium Webdriver API(6) 33、右键 context_click 在某个对象上点击右键#encoding=utf-8from selenium import webdriverimport unittestimport timefrom selenium.webdriver 阅读全文
posted @ 2019-03-13 17:53 测试小子 阅读(181) 评论(0) 推荐(0) 编辑
摘要: Selenium Webdriver API(4) 27、操作复选框 checkBox#encoding=utf-8import unittestimport timefrom selenium import webdriver class VisitLocalWebByIE(unittest.Te 阅读全文
posted @ 2019-02-27 15:39 测试小子 阅读(316) 评论(0) 推荐(0) 编辑